It looks like VLC entered the straight line towards a new stable build as the developer uploaded to their servers today the first release candidate for version 2.0.1.

The current revision (available for Windows, Mac and Linux) follows three pre-releases and is supposed to bring the user a much better experience with improved functionality and stability. However, there aren’t any details available just yet.

During its development, each major stable release of VLC media player received a codename. At the beginning, they were based on characters from the movie Goldeneye (Onatopp, Ourumov, Natalya, Trevelyan, Bond, Goldeneye, etc.).

Starting version 1.1.x, the developer chose the codenames from Terry Prachett’s Discworld. The moniker for build 1.1.x was The Luggage, while for the current major build (2.0.x) it is Twoflower.

For the upcoming stable release (2.1.x), the codename chosen is Rincewind and the one following (2.2.x) will be named WeatherWax.
